Cashback bonus and the Protection It Provides

If free spins are the thrilling weekend, cashback is the reliable umbrella on a rainy day. This bonus turned into my preferred during the test. Reelson has different cashback promos, usually weekly, where you get a percentage of your net losses back. The massive difference is between “real money” cashback and “bonus” cashback. I saw both. Real money cashback is the best. That money is yours right away, ready to withdraw or play under normal conditions. Bonus cashback holds the funds with another set of wagering rules. For UK players who like lengthy sessions, even a consistent 10% cashback deal makes a difference. It reduces a bad run and technically lowers the house advantage. My advice? Look for the real money cashback offers. They’re the most straightforward and useful bonus you can get.

The Enduring Appeal of Free Spins Offers

Free spins are the bright bait on the hook. Reelson provides them in a few ways: as part of the welcome deal, as daily or weekly treats, and for new slot launches. I tried them all. The “no deposit” spins, usually given just for verifying your account, are the best bet. They let you explore the place without risk. The catch? Winnings from them often come with very high wagering and a strict cap on how much you can actually take out. The deposit-based free spins offers more punch. I noticed Reelson often links these to specific, popular slots. That’s fun, but irritating if you don’t like that particular game. My rule of thumb? Review the details. See if the spins land all at once or drip-feed over a week. Review the win cap and the wagering. An offer for 50 spins can sometimes be poorer than an offer for 20 spins with friendlier terms. It’s always a balance between quantity and quality.

Essential Checks for Any Free Spins Offer:

  • Are they “no deposit” or based on a deposit? This determines your risk.
  • What is the particular slot game they are valid on? Make sure it’s one you enjoy.
  • What is the per-spin value? 50 spins at £0.10 is £5 total value; 20 spins at £0.50 is £10.
  • What is the maximum withdrawal limit from the winnings? A low cap can cancel out a big win.
  • How many days do you have to claim the spins? They often expire quickly.

Key Fine Print Every Player Must Decode

All my testing reduced to one simple fact: the bonus terms and conditions are the rulebook. If you ignore them, you’re playing a distinct game to the casino. I analyzed Reelson’s T&Cs to identify the essential checks for UK players. First, wagering requirements (WR) appear as “35x”. Does that multiply just the bonus, or your deposit plus the bonus? You need to know. Second, game weighting is what makes or breaks a bonus. A 35x WR on slots is clear. That same WR on a game that counts 10% means a 350x effective playthrough. Third, maximum bet limits with bonus funds are firm, often £5 or less. Go over, and they can void your winnings. Fourth, time limits are usually short, from 24 hours for free spin winnings to a week for a deposit match. That stress can cause bad decisions. My top tip? If any term is confusing, ask customer support to explain it before you deposit. Guessing can be expensive.

The Essential Pre-Claim Checklist:

  1. Locate and review the full bonus terms and conditions for that particular offer.
  2. Determine the wagering requirement multiplier and what it covers (bonus only or bonus+deposit).
  3. Check the game contribution table. What percentage do your preferred games count for?
  4. Take note of the maximum bet allowed when playing with bonus funds.
  5. Verify the time limit you have to fulfill the wagering requirements.
  6. Search for any excluded games or software providers that are excluded from bonus play.
  7. Confirm the withdrawal limits or caps on winnings derived from the bonus.

FAQ

What’s the single most important term to verify for any Reelson bonus?

Check the game contribution rates. A 35x wagering requirement looks okay, but if your preferred game only contributes 10%, your actual playthrough requirement is 350x. Always find the table in the terms that shows what percentage each game type represents. This single factor changes the entire value of the bonus.

Are no deposit bonuses at Reelson Casino a good deal?

Yes, but keep your expectations in check. They give you a true risk-free way to explore the casino’s software and games. The downside is the winnings usually have high wagering attached, approximately 50x or more, and a low ceiling on how much you can withdraw. Consider them as a free sample that might net you a little cash, not a jackpot ticket.

How does the cashback bonus function, and is it good for players?

Cashback gives back a percentage of your net losses over a period, typically a week. It’s a great player-friendly feature because it smooths out your losses. The big question is whether it’s “real money” or “bonus” cashback. Real money cashback is far better, as it’s either withdrawable immediately or has minimal playthrough. Find out which one Reelson is offering on that particular promotion.

Can I play any game with my bonus funds?

Absolutely not, you can’t. This is a key restriction. Bonus funds have game weighting. The majority of online slots represent 100%, but table games like blackjack or roulette frequently count 5-10%. Some games or even whole software providers may be blocked entirely. Make sure to check the list before you get started, or you face having your bonus cancelled.

What is the outcome if I try to withdraw before meeting wagering requirements?

The casino will generally remove the whole bonus amount and any winnings you made from it. The software automatically tracks this. If you seek to cash out early, those funds simply disappear. You have to monitor your wagering progress in your account and only request a withdrawal once the requirement is entirely met.

Do my deposits apply towards wagering requirements?

It is contingent on the bonus. For the majority of deposit matches, the wagering applies to the bonus amount alone. But some promotions state “bonus + deposit” wagering, which is a considerably bigger number. The terms will detail this. Never make an assumption. Make sure to check what the multiplier is calculated on.

How long do I typically have to complete bonus wagering?

Deadlines vary. Winnings from free spins frequently need to be wagered within 24 hours. Standard deposit match bonuses generally give you between 3 and 7 days. The clock begins counting the moment the bonus is credited to your account. If you do not complete in time, you give up the bonus and any winnings tied to it, so note the expiry.
